Emergency Call
Initiating an Emergency Call
Press the
Emergency
key and you can initiate an emergency call to the predefined contact. Any
individual contact, group contact, default group, PSTN or PABX contact can be predefined as the
emergency contact.
There are two levels for emergency call: emergency priority and pre-emptive priority 3, which can be
programmed by your dealer. The emergency priority is endowed with the higher privilege; thus a call with
such priority can break any other call with pre-emptive priority 3, as well as calls with lower priorities.
Answering an Emergency Call
The emergency call is always received automatically. During an emergency call, the calling party can
talk with no need to use any key. If another member needs to talk, he/she should hold down
PTT
only
after the talking party stops talking and releases its
PTT
.
